5-star historic hotel with views of Big Ben and the London Eye
Amenities
The 25-metre indoor swimming pool is open all year and heated for guest use. The M Club Lounge on the 5th floor offers all-day refreshments and panoramic views of Big Ben. A comprehensive fitness centre and a business centre with fax/photocopying services are available on-site.
Rooms
Each room has a marble bathroom, Egyptian cotton sheets, bathrobes, slippers, and an LCD TV with satellite channels. Some rooms offer direct views of the River Thames and the London Eye from the window. The hotel is a Grade II listed building that opened in 1922 as the original County Hall.
Location
The hotel is a 5-minute walk from Westminster Station and a 10-minute walk from Waterloo Station. Big Ben, the London Eye, and Westminster Abbey are all within a 15-minute walk from the building. Buckingham Palace can be reached on foot in less than 25 minutes.
Dining
Gillray's Steakhouse & Bar overlooks the River Thames and serves steaks and English traditional food made from locally sourced ingredients. The Library offers an award-winning traditional British Afternoon Tea in the historic former county hall library with original bookcases. Breakfast is served each morning in the restaurant with a wide selection of options.
Family and Children
Babysitting and child services can be arranged through the concierge team. Kids' meals are available on the restaurant menu and through room service. The on-site candy shop operates on an honour system with proceeds going to a local charity.
